DVB-S2 Simulator: A Comprehensive Overview

Introduction

DVB-S2 Simulator is a powerful software tool designed for simulating the Digital Video Broadcasting - Satellite - Second Generation (DVB-S2) standard. This advanced simulator enables engineers and researchers to analyze and optimize satellite communication systems by providing realistic modeling of satellite link parameters and performance metrics.

History

The DVB-S2 standard was developed by the Digital Video Broadcasting project and was officially adopted in 2005. As satellite communication evolved, the need for sophisticated simulation tools became apparent. The DVB-S2 Simulator emerged as a vital resource for professionals in the telecommunications field, facilitating the analysis of complex satellite systems and enabling the development of more efficient transmission techniques.

Over the years, the simulator has undergone several updates to incorporate advances in technology and to enhance user experience. The inclusion of modern modulation techniques and error correction methods has made it an essential tool for anyone working in satellite communications.
